+
+/*
+ * Manage filename-based font source selectors
+ */
+
+FcBool
+FcConfigGlobAdd (FcConfig *config,
+ const FcChar8 *glob,
+ FcBool accept)
+{
+ FcStrSet *set = accept ? config->acceptGlobs : config->rejectGlobs;
+
+ return FcStrSetAdd (set, glob);
+}
+
+static FcBool
+FcConfigGlobMatch (const FcChar8 *glob,
+ const FcChar8 *string)
+{
+ FcChar8 c;
+
+ while ((c = *glob++))
+ {
+ switch (c) {
+ case '*':
+ /* short circuit common case */
+ if (!*glob)
+ return FcTrue;
+ /* short circuit another common case */
+ if (strchr ((char *) glob, '*') == 0)
+ string += strlen ((char *) string) - strlen ((char *) glob);
+ while (*string)
+ {
+ if (FcConfigGlobMatch (glob, string))
+ return FcTrue;
+ string++;
+ }
+ return FcFalse;
+ case '?':
+ if (*string++ == '\0')
+ return FcFalse;
+ break;
+ default:
+ if (*string++ != c)
+ return FcFalse;
+ break;
+ }
+ }
+ return *string == '\0';
+}
+
+static FcBool
+FcConfigGlobsMatch (const FcStrSet *globs,
+ const FcChar8 *string)
+{
+ int i;
+
+ for (i = 0; i < globs->num; i++)
+ if (FcConfigGlobMatch (globs->strs[i], string))
+ return FcTrue;
+ return FcFalse;
+}
+
+FcBool
+FcConfigAcceptFilename (FcConfig *config,
+ const FcChar8 *filename)
+{
+ if (FcConfigGlobsMatch (config->acceptGlobs, filename))
+ return FcTrue;
+ if (FcConfigGlobsMatch (config->rejectGlobs, filename))
+ return FcFalse;
+ return FcTrue;
+}
